## Limits & Quotas: Lessons from the Stale-Cache Incident

Quick recap for support folks: last month the Fernwick catalog service kept serving week-old prices because the cache TTL and the invalidation sweep were fighting each other. Customers saw discounts that had expired, tickets piled up, and nobody was happy. We've since pinned the relevant knobs so this can't silently drift again. If a customer reports stale prices, check these values before escalating to the Bramblepath team. Current settings are shown below.

tuning constants:
QUOTAS = {
    "druwyn": 5,
    "holix": 5,
    "zorath": 5,
    "holwyn": 10,
}

Ticket LIFT-412: The elevator-dispatch simulator for the Marrowgate tower model now supports destination-dispatch grouping. Validation runs match recorded morning-peak traffic within 4% on average wait time. Remaining work: document the idle-parking heuristic and tag a release for the planning team. Ready to merge pending sign-off from the simulator owner named below.

account owner for bawip-tahag: Raleth Quenok

**Vendor note: Inkmill markdown pipeline**

Rendering for Parchway docs is outsourced to Inkmill under an annual contract, renewing each March. They handle sanitization and PDF export; we own the upload queue. SLA: 4-hour response on rendering failures. Escalate only after two failed retries. Their support desk is reachable at the address below.

billing contact of hahaf-baguf = zorael.tammir.jorius@sivrelhq.internal

Welcome to on-call for the Glimmerpane design system! Our snapshot tests live in the `snapcheck` suite and run on every merge to main. If a UI component changes visually, the diff bot flags it — usually it's an intentional tweak, so just approve the new baseline. If it's 2am and snapshots are failing across the board, it's almost always a font-loading race, not your problem. To unlock the baseline store and re-approve snapshots in bulk, use the recovery passphrase below.

recovery phrase for tahag-taguf: wenix-caswyn